Abstract

Multivariate Analysis of Variance (MANOVA) is a quantitative data analysis technique to determine the significance of differences in more than two means of dependent variables. The Manova requirements test includes multivariate normality test with Mardia test and covariance matrix homogeneity test with Box's M test. There are several Manova test statistics, namely Wilks' Lambda, Pillai, Lawley-Hotelling, and Roy's Largest Root. The difficulty of multivariate analysis in calculations that are too complicated has been solved by the existence of statistical software that is increasingly sophisticated, so that it is able to explain the changes or effects of the treatment given and its interactions.The purpose of this study is to analyze the use of Manova in MIPA and health education research. The method used is literature review.
